jBPM入门指南:环境配置与3.1.1版本实践
需积分: 0 179 浏览量
更新于2024-12-30
收藏 290KB PDF 举报
jBPM开发入门指南是一份针对初学者的实用文档,介绍了如何在当前工作流技术快速发展的背景下,选择和使用jBPM这款流行的开源工作流引擎。工作流系统的重要性在于其能够处理任务分配、审批流程等复杂的业务流程,而jBPM以其灵活性和可扩展性吸引了众多企业,尤其是那些已采用JBoss架构的公司。
文档首先强调了jBPM的历史背景,指出它最初是独立的开源项目,后来被JBoss收购,成为了其产品线的一部分。尽管jBPM的设计会随着版本更新而有所变化,因此旧有的教程可能存在不适用之处。作者分享了自己在实际工作中从shark工作流引擎切换到jBPM的经验,指出了shark在性能优化方面的不足,从而促使作者对jBPM进行深入研究和实践。
在环境准备部分,指南详细说明了开发jBPM所需的基础设施。首先,开发者需要安装Java Development Kit (JDK),这是所有Java开发的基础,确保JAVA_HOME环境变量被正确设置。接下来,Ant工具必不可少,它在jBPM项目构建过程中发挥关键作用。用户需要下载Apache Ant的最新版本,将其解压并配置系统变量。
Eclipse虽非jBPM开发的强制要求,但其提供了强大的支持和便捷的开发插件,极大地提高了开发效率。指南推荐了Eclipse 3.2作为开发环境,并提供了jBPM的下载链接,包括jBPM软件包、开发插件以及预配置的基于JBoss的示例和数据库配置文件示例。
这份jBPM开发入门指南为读者提供了一个从零开始,逐步了解和掌握jBPM开发的清晰路径,无论是初次接触工作流引擎还是希望改进现有系统的开发者,都能从中获益匪浅。随着指南的深入,读者将学习到如何创建流程定义、执行流程实例、以及如何利用Eclipse插件进行调试和管理等工作流开发的核心技能。
128 浏览量
134 浏览量
2007-10-18 上传
103 浏览量
116 浏览量
142 浏览量
2008-09-06 上传
2021-09-30 上传
2021-10-11 上传
leaderbird
- 粉丝: 27
- 资源: 40
最新资源
- 领智网站内容管理系统 v2.0 SP2 Build 0620
- dirty-chai:用不掉毛的终止声明扩展Chai
- 单片机C语言实例-用PG12864LCD设计的指针式电子钟.zip
- glHack:glHack 是 NetHack 3.4 的全屏 SDL 端口-开源
- UDP单播通信,UDP 协议-综合文档
- 使用SpringBoot开发的基于HBASE的大数据存储分布式云计算笔记(后端).zip
- jdk-8u152-windows-x64
- chatbotTimeZone:带有Rasa和Python的小聊天机器人,可获取任何城市的时区
- ts-jest-boilerplate:用于TypeScript的TDD样板。 包括棉短袜!
- share:Android 开源交流 QQ 群分享
- Forecasting-Monthly-Dengue-Cases-Using-Climatic-Factors-In-Colombo-District-With-Machine-Learning.:关键字词
- 单片机C语言实例-外部中断0边沿触发.zip
- Verilog HDL 综合实用教程-综合文档
- ud_vs_sud:比较依赖语法的两种方法的可学习性
- 营销策划方案审查表
- loraham:70cm上的LoRa的Ham无线电协议和Arduino示例